Alice was really onto something when she discovered that a mirror can transform a simple space into an extraordinary one.

While not all looking glasses lead to Wonderland, decorating with these versatile gems can still be an adventure. When properly placed, they illuminate dark corners and create illusions of space. Plus, they can reflect your personal flair.
